nonce-wd. [f. as prec.: see -FICATION.] A twisting; a twisted object or part.

1

1825.  Examiner, 6 Nov., 4/1. As far as limb-work and personal twistification are concerned, M. Mazurier may use the same exclamation in regard to his ligneous competitor.

2

1835.  Beckford, Recoll., 137. To entertain any doubts of the supreme excellence of Don Emanuel’s scollops and twistifications amounted to heresy.

3

1841.  Hawthorne, Amer. Note-bks. (1883), 230. Dry jokes, the humor of which is so incorporated with the strange twistifications of his physiognomy, that [etc.].
